Oxytocin can be
very useful for
helping labor.
However, there are
certain risks with
using it. Oxytocin
causes contractions
of the uterus. In
women who are
unusually sensitive
to its effects, these
contractions may
become too strong.
1. Continuously monitor
contractions, fetal and
maternal heart rate, and
maternal blood pressure
andECG.
2. Discontinueinfusion if
uterinehyperactivity occurs.
3. Monitor patientextremely
closelyduring first
andsecond stages oflabor
because of riskof cervical
laceration,uterine rupture
andmaternal and fetaldeath.
4. Assess fluid intakeand
output. Watch forsigns and
symptomsof water
intoxication

Be alert for adverse
reactions and drug
interactions. This drug
should be used extremely
carefully because of its
potent vasoconstrictor
action. I.V. use may induce
sudden hypertension and
cerebrovascular accidents.
As a last resort, give I.V.
slowly over several minutes
and monitor blood pressure
closely.

Generic: 2%
Lidocaine
Brand:
Classification
Antiarrhythmic,
Anesthetic (local
and general)
5mL
(100mg/5mL)
An amide type local
anaesthetic. It
stabilizes the
neuronal membrane
and inhibits sodium
ion movements, which
are necessary for
conduction of
impulses. In the heart,
lidocaine reduces
phase 4depolarisation
and automaticity.
Duration of action
potential and effective
refractory period are
also reduced.
